CHAOS ENGINE

BREAK ASSUMPTIONS.
MEASURE RECOVERY.

AUTHORIZED EXTERNAL OPERATIONS
  • Maximum 4 requests per second
  • Maximum 4 concurrent probes
  • Maximum 240 total requests
  • Live SLO aborts
  • Emergency stop
  • Recovery measurement
  • Sealed evidence
SEALED ACADEMY POWER DOMAIN
  • Maximum 500 requests per second
  • Maximum 100 workers
  • Maximum 30,000 requests
  • Disposable bundled target only
  • No internet egress
  • No host mounts
  • No published target ports
  • Automatic teardown

External resilience experiments are rate-ceilinged, abortable and evidence-sealed measurements of recovery behaviour on systems inside your attested authorization boundary. Unrestricted load work stays inside the disposable, egress-free Academy power domain.

Does buying FieldOps authorize me to test a target?

No. A license unlocks the software only. Authorization comes from the system owner in writing, and FieldOps enforces the scope you declare.

Can FieldOps test real systems?

Yes — public external systems, or exact internal systems when they are explicitly included in an active, attested engagement. FieldOps enforces the declared targets, ports, network boundary and testing window.

What is the difference between FieldOps and the sealed Academy ranges?

Academy ranges are disposable, contained targets built for learning. FieldOps operates against real systems inside an attested authorization boundary and seals the resulting evidence.

Where is engagement data stored?

Locally on your machine. Engagements, evidence captures and the operations ledger are local-first artifacts you export yourself.
